1.自定义的组件上添加样式名不起效
2.当用自定义组件A包裹组件B时,B中的数据绑定失效,无法获得data值,即组件多层嵌套会有问题。
3.有时候向template中添加DOM元素的时候,尤其是添加自定义组件,dev热更新不会显示出来,需要重启dev才会生效,初步认为是mpvue存在缓存。
4.原生input输入框双向绑定时监听input事件会引起光标闪烁的问题,应改为监听change事件。
5.同一路由切换时,上一次的页面数据会保留。
问题描述
解决方案
6.mpvue生成的页面各自使用一个vue示例,导致store无法全局共享。解决方案,将配置好的store绑定到vue的原型链上使得每个vue示例都可以继承使用。
7.小程序中打开的页面过多时,页面会失去相应,所以页面跳转尽量用wx.redirectTo而不是wx.navigationTo
8.当在input输入框输入完后直接点击按钮提交事件时(经历了输入框失去焦点change事件触发迟于提交按钮click事件触发),发生提交的数据为空的情况。解决方案,对相应的click事件用定时器进行延时触发。
9.在template中类似$store.state.user.name的值无法获取,需要放到计算属性中。
mpvue开发过程中遇到的问题
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 前言 您将在本文当中了解到,往网页中添加数据,从传统的dom操作过渡到数据层操作,实现同一个目标,两种不同的方式....